Eihab Boraie ventures to New Cairo's Downtown Mall to check out Super Stash - a hobbyists heaven filled with comic books, classic vinyls and every quirky collectible in between.

But making memories through the passionate purchases is difficult in Egypt. Luckily, Super Stash – a new boutique hobby store in Downtown Mall – is changing that.

My growing despair had me in a funk, feeling hopeless until this past weekend when I was meandering around New Cairo’s Downtown Mall and stumbled upon salvation at Super Stash. Walking through the doors felt like I was entering a collector’s heaven. On my right walls adorned with stacks of legendary graphic novels and single issues comic books. In front of me a mystical landscape filled with colourfully painted Warhammer characters, and on my left, boxes labelled by genres filled with vinyl. Instantly I made my way to the records and started crate digging for gold. In the hunt I found a diverse array of sounds ranging from Daft Punk and the Arctic monkeys to essential Hendrix and The Doors’ albums. I want to grab them all, but sadly my turn tables were unable to make the move to Egypt and I was record player-less. Noticing my discontent I was approached by the owner, Mahmoud Maktad, who informed me that “Super Stash will be offering a catalogue that will allow customers to purchase custom designed professional turntables from us.”

It seemed to me that Maktad, a collector himself, had thought of everything a hobbyist would need when putting together the place. We talked for quite a bit about our passions, the state of vinyl and graphic novels collecting in Egypt, and how a place like Super Stash is needed if a community would emerge. What surprised me the most is that although I happened to be at their opening, Maktad wasn’t shy to positively mention his competitors, realising that without supporting each other there could be no chance of forming a community. “There are only two places to buy comic books, Super Stash and Kryptonite. We particularly focus on single issues that come out every month and appreciate in value with time.”

I ended up spending over an hour going through the vinyl, comics and variety of miscellaneous collector items that I never imagined I would find in Egypt. It was becoming very clear that I would be spending a lot of money here, but unprepared all I could only afford at the time was a Star Wars omnibus graphic novel and a Futurama key chain.
